How to Defeat Godskin Duo in Elden Ring?
There are two schools of thought for defeating the Godskin Duo in Elden Ring.
- Fight them legally. If you want a direct, challenging and frustrating boss fight against the Godskin Duo, you first need to know how to fight both the Godskin Apostle and the Godskin Noble. The versions in the duo fight are stronger versions of the Apostles and Nobles you fight elsewhere in Elden Ring. The only difference now is that they are together. My biggest advice for a dual legal challenge is to not put them both in phase two at the same time. Noble will roll around the arena and knock you around at the speed of sound, and Apostle will throw out delayed attacks like candy. Use stone trellises to separate the two bosses and focus on killing one before dealing too much with the other.
- Make them defenseless with sleep. I hate the Godskin Duo and will never legally fight them again. Both Noble and Apostle are vulnerable to the Sleep condition, which actually knocks them out for a few minutes. If you're using an Arcane build, Sleep Arrows are a quick and easy way to apply status, and you don't need an upgraded bow to do it. Just grab a Shortbow, equip Barrage Ash of War on it, and go to town. Then you can use Bleed arrows somehow. If you don't have Arcane for the appropriate Sleep stack at range, throw Sleep Pots at the Duo's feet. In my fights (I've had it a few times), one pot was enough to Put both Noble and Apostle to Sleep if they were close together and I had good aim. I could then get three fully charged heavy attacks for free, which is a free riposte with greatsword weapons.
Remember: While playing Elden Ring, you need to completely deplete the health bars to defeat the Godskin Duo boss. You can't kill either of them before the bar is empty. After about a minute they will respawn and you will have to keep killing them until they remain dead.
Of the two, I always found Apostle easier to fight, as I could never get Noble's fat roll to fly very well. However, it's much easier to keep the big guy at arm's length, and it doesn't matter which of the Two you shoot. Damage dealt to someone is damage to the boss's collective health, so if you want to ignore someone completely, that's your prerogative.
So what's the short version of beating the Godskin Duo? Focus on one and keep the other dormant forever. Bring your best weapons with you, especially those with Bleed, and stay around the pillar bases after they fall.
